摘要
Tuberculosis mostly affects the lungs, but many unusual localizations has been reported [1- 3]. The course of the disease could be extremely serious if the diagnosis is missed. We're reporting here a 50-year- old man suffering from right lower back pain for 02 weeks, with loss of weight and deterioration of the general sate. The clinical exam revealed a wheelbase of the right lumbar fossa and inflammatory skin signs. The biological assessment showed moderate inflammatory syndrome. Abdominal CT was performed, showing a voluminous right retroperitoneal abscess in pre-fistulization in the skin, measuring 10.7x8.4x6.7 cm, exerting an important mass effect on the ipsi-lateral kidney (Figures A & B). Percutaneous drainage was performed first. The bacteriological analysis of the purulent fluid affirmed tubercular origin. An antituberculosis treatment was introduced with good clinical and radiological evolution. In endemic regions and in patients with HIV infection [4], diagnosis of tuberculosis abscess should not be missed out.
